BIOL 863 Course Description

Title: The Role of Science in Restoration and Management of the San Francisco Estuary
GE Status:
U.S. History and Government:
Prerequisites: graduate status and consent of instructor.
Term(s) Offered:
Units: (2)
Description: Key scientific issues about San Francisco Estuary and watershed, how they affect and are affected by management and restoration actions, and how restoration goals influence the scientific approach to management.
Effective: Fall 2000
Latest Offering: Fall 2000
